      OpenCV 4 for Secret Agents is an updated edition of the book that introduced thousands of developers to cat face detection, real-time Eulerian video magnification, and other scintillating topics in computer vision. Now, Python 3 and Android Studio are supported. With an applied approach and a love of storytelling, the author presents projects ...

    • "The Girl in the Water" by Joseph Howse, winner of the 2023 Independent Press Award, is a complex tale of a young Ukrainian girl in the late 1980s, blending literary styles reminiscent of Tolstoy and Dostoevsky. The narrative is described as tightly composed yet filled with passion and allegory.

      Focusing on the grammar and syntax of the Cree language, Joseph Howse's study provides an in-depth analysis of its phonology, morphology, and vocabulary, alongside a discussion of the Chippeway dialect. The book explores the historical development and cultural significance of Cree, making it a valuable resource for linguists and anthropologists. This facsimile reprint aims to preserve the original work while promoting the study of this important indigenous language of North America.
